The Wielki Giewont is a mountain in the Polish West Tatras at 1894 meters in the Giewont massif , of which it is the highest peak.
Location and surroundings
Below the summit lie the Dolina Strążyska , Dolina Małej Łąki and Dolina Kondratowa valleys . On the summit there is a 15-meter-high summit cross visible from afar, which was erected in 1901.

Routes to the summit
The hiking trail to the Wielki Giewont leads along the main ridge of the Tatra Mountains and the Polish-Slovak border.
- ▬ A blue hiking trail leads fromthe Kuźnice districtof Zakopane over the Kondracka Przełęcz mountain passto the summit.
- ▬ A red marked hiking trail leads from the Dolina Strążyska valleyover the Kondracka Przełęcz mountain passto the summit.
- ▬ A yellow hiking trail leads from the Kościelisko district of Gronik over the Kondracka Przełęcz mountain passto the summit.
The Kondratowa Hut , Ornak Hut and Chochołowska Hut are suitable starting points for an ascent from the valleys .
